2007-03-22 Thread Jesse Kuhnert

Well...Looking at the javadocs I'd say you need to do something more like:

cycle.getEngine().getService(Tapestry.PAGE_SERVICE).getLink(cycle,
page, new Object[] { "Your .page name "}).getURL()

You can also try getAbsoluteURL() if it's not putting the
http//context/ stuff in there for some reason.
